Comparison review

Sony Xperia Z3+ is slightly better than the Asus PadFone Infinity, with a 73.7 score against 68.6. The Sony Xperia Z3+ body is notably newer, a little lighter and thinner than Asus PadFone Infinity. These devices have Android OS, but Sony Xperia Z3+ has newer 5.0 version and Asus PadFone Infinity has Android 4.4.

The Asus PadFone Infinity features a bit more powerful CPU than Sony Xperia Z3+, because although it has 1 GB lesser RAM, it also counts with 3 more processing cores and an additional GPU. The Asus PadFone Infinity counts with just a bit better looking display than Xperia Z3+, because although it has a little bit smaller display, and they both have an equal resolution of 1920 x 1080, the Asus PadFone Infinity also counts with a quite higher pixel density.

The Xperia Z3+ takes much clearer videos and photos than Asus PadFone Infinity, and although they both have the same aperture, the Xperia Z3+ also has a back camera with way more MP and a way better 3840x2160 video quality. The Xperia Z3+ features just a bit bigger memory for apps and games than Asus PadFone Infinity, because although it has 0 less internal storage capacity, it also counts with an external memory slot that supports a maximum of 128 GB.

The Sony Xperia Z3+ counts with improved battery performance than Asus PadFone Infinity, because it has 2930mAh of battery capacity.

Even being the best phone of the ones in this comparison, the Sony Xperia Z3+ is also cheaper than the Asus PadFone Infinity, making it an easy choice.
